Output 6fc62d7eba2d3b23ffb88a7de4d9d45f495b76b9c899c51aa9a2beae751e2963:2

value
975150
script pubkey
OP_HASH160 OP_PUSHBYTES_20 223afd91feede44a13bbbc99c61018822b7e873b OP_EQUAL
address
34p1ZoG6RJxDLzshUtyxp6W1GQVpnbrZyf
transaction
6fc62d7eba2d3b23ffb88a7de4d9d45f495b76b9c899c51aa9a2beae751e2963
confirmations
108926
spent
true